The Union took over first place in the Eastern Conference after beating Cincinnati 2-0 behind two second half goals from Kacper Przybylko and Fafa Picault on Wednesday night in Chester.
The Union grew into the match after a slow start, and really outpaced Cincinnati from the 20th minute on. There was only one switch to the lineup from last Saturday’s match against Vancouver, with Fafa sliding into Accam’s spot up top. Ray Gaddis filled in at left back again for the suspended Kai Wagner, while Olivier Mbaizo slotted in on the right for Gaddis.
Mbaizo really bounced back from a shaky season debut against Vancouver.
